Kingsbury T.D.L Authentic Trinidad Rum 2003 18yr 62,7%
The "Authentic Trinidad Rum" was produced in Trinidad at the T.D.L distillery. It was selected and bottled by the independent bottler Kingsbury. It was distilled in 2003 from Molasses and then aged for 18 years. The rum has an ABV of 62,7%.

“What a Blast. Alkohol nahezu nicht schmeckbar trotz über 60%. Geschmäcker alle top integriert. Wunderbar komplex und elegant. Hoffe ich krieg davon was ab für einen Quervergleich. Kommt mir vor als hätten eine reguläre TDL 2003 Abfüllung mit der 99er Fernandes Abfüllung von TWCC und einem Caroni ein Kind zusammen gross gezogen. Aus der Hüfte würde ich ihn aber als besten seines Jahrgangs bezeichnen, der mir unter die Nase gekommen ist. Exquisit. Minzig, fruchtig, Fruchtsüsse, Tabak, leicht rauchig, getrocknete Früchte, Fass, sirup, Gummi, tropische Früchte, Gewürze.”
